Corruption in MS Access database due to affect on System Resources

by John

It is the data which we enter into our MS Access databases and to make the process simple, forms are there. The Ms Access forms make the editing, insertion and replacing of the records very easy and closer to graphical environment. But in few of the cases when you open and close a form repeatedly hundred of times in a MS Access database during the same session, you may encounter an error messages that announces:



“There isn't enough memory to update the display. Close unneeded programs and try again.”



Or



“Microsoft Access was unable to create a window. The system is out of resources or memory. Close unneeded programs and try again.

For more information on freeing memory, search the Microsoft Windows Help index for 'memory, troubleshooting'.”



In these cases you may also feel that the system is responding very slowly. Actually the reason is that when each time you open an Access form in Windows, a small amount of GDI Resources are taken and is not released.



The GDI resources are the core components of any OS that are responsible for providing the interface for graphical objects including fonts and formatted text. The GDI interacts with the device drivers on behalf of applications. When the form is opened rarely, they remained unnoticed but in case they are opened very often or for long period of time, you may feel the performance problems and out-of-memory errors. In addition to that the frequent opening of the form may also result in the corruption and in these situations, Access Repair is required.



To resolve out the issue Microsoft has recommended having Microsoft Office 2000 Service Release 1/1a (SR-1/SR-1a). This service pack will sort out your problems for future but is unable to repair the already corrupted Access databases.
